Servidor Postgresql não iniciado no Ubuntu 14.04

14

Meu problema é depois do postgresql instalado tentar configurar o banco de dados postgresql é mostrar a mensagem de erro como abaixo:

dineshlap@ss-laptop:~$ sudo -u postgres psql postgres
psql: could not connect to server: No such file or directory
    Is the server running locally and accepting
    connections on Unix domain socket "/var/run/postgresql/.s.PGSQL.5432"?

e eu tentei muitas soluções da internet. mas nada funcionou para mim! : (

Se você conhece a solução para este problema, por favor, responda este post!

Nota: Estou usando o Ubuntu 14.04 (64 bits) e o postgresql 9.3

    
por Dinesh 21.05.2015 / 13:21

3 respostas

22

Apenas tente reiniciar

sudo /etc/init.d/postgresql restart

isso funcionou para mim:)

    
por Talal 13.06.2015 / 15:55
2

Ubuntu16.04 e 9.3

sudo systemctl restart postgresql-9.3.service

Talvez você descubra o serviço antes de reiniciar o servidor

service --status-all
    
por Giang Bui Truong 11.01.2017 / 03:50
0

Em alguns casos, você pode ter problemas de permissão. Eu crio um script de shell assim:

#!/bin/bash

chown -R $User:$User /var/run/postgresql
sudo /etc/init.d/postgresql restart

substitua $ User por seu nome de usuário e execute o arquivo (assumindo que o nome do arquivo seja postgresql.sh ):

sudo ./postgresrun.sh
    
por Seyed Morteza Mousavi 22.03.2017 / 09:15